
Mt. Wilson was where Edwin Hubble first discovered in the 20s that the universe extended beyond our Milky Way, and where Albert Einstein went to work on his theory of general relativity. Since then, light pollution from LA has forced most astronomers away from this beautiful observatory and off to darker skies in Hawaii and elsewhere–but to know that we peered through the same lens at the universe as Edwin Hubble and Albert Einstein renders me speechless.
